Zootah, nestled in the scenic surroundings of Logan, Utah, presents an enchanting escape for animal lovers and families alike. This charming zoo is home to an impressive array of wildlife, showcasing both native and exotic species in a beautifully landscaped environment. From playful otters to majestic birds and reptiles, each exhibit provides a unique glimpse into the animal kingdom. The layout of Zootah encourages exploration, allowing visitors to stroll through the lush grounds, where they can enjoy close encounters with animals while learning about their habitats and behaviors. In addition to its diverse animal exhibits, Zootah offers numerous recreational activities that enhance the visitor experience. Families can partake in interactive sessions that promote wildlife education and conservation efforts. The zoo also features picnic areas, making it an excellent spot for a leisurely lunch amidst nature. With its commitment to providing a fun and educational experience, Zootah serves as a vital resource for understanding wildlife and the importance of conservation. Visiting Zootah is not just about observing animals, but also about engaging with nature and fostering a love for wildlife. Whether you're a local or a tourist, this inviting zoo is a must-see destination that promises memorable moments and a deeper appreciation for the natural world.

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ving, head toward Logan, Utah. From the center of Logan, take Main Street and head south. Turn left onto 700 South. Continue on 700 South for about half a mile, and Zootah will be on your right at 419 W 700 S. There is parking available on-site, but it's advisable to arrive early, especially on weekends, as the zoo can get busy.

  • Public Transportation

    If you are using public transportation, check the Cache Valley Transit District (CVTD) for bus routes that service Logan. You can take the Route 1 bus, which runs through the main areas of Logan. Disembark at the nearest stop to 700 South, then walk approximately 10 minutes south on Main Street before turning left onto 700 South. Zootah will be approximately half a mile down on your right side. Be sure to check the current bus schedules for any costs associated with riding the bus, which typically ranges from $1 to $2 per ride.
